Omeruo Nets Brace As Pembroke Athleta Go Top
Published: December 21, 2014
Olympic National Team invitee Lucky Omeruo netted a brace for his team Pembroke Athleta in their 3 - 1 win over Zurrieq in the latest round of matches in the Maltese First Division.
The offensive all-rounder opened scoring in the 16th minute for the second - tier table toppers before netting a second ten minutes from time.
The former Standard Liege and ADO Den Haag trialist has netted 7 goals in all competitions this season, with 5 coming in the championship.
In the race for the title, Pembroke Athleta are one point ahead of Gudja United, Vittoriosa Stars and St. Andrews.
Lucky Omeruo penned a one - season deal with Pembroke Athleta this summer.
